About The Position

The Quality Inspector is responsible for inspecting and testing parts to ensure that they meet dimensional and functional specifications. YOUR 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ES Responsible for inspecting and testing parts to ensure that they meet dimensional and functional specifications. Complete inspection reports using the Levels of Inspection or CRM Report computer software. Process parts by creating a Non-Conforming Report for parts that have been determined to be defective, incomplete or incorrect. Assist with First Article Inspections as needed. Look for trends in recurring defects for all inspected parts. Utilize 5S practices (sort, straighten, clean, organize, and sustain the inspection workspace). Assist with non-conforming projects (clarifications) as needed. Work as a liaison between Quality and Production (Receiving and Packaging Departments when needed). Include suggestions on packaging/kitting when noticing that a part could benefit from it. Perform special assignments on occasion. Warehouse work. Computer usage at the desk. Moves between office, warehouse, production, and inspection areas to perform tasks.
